Okay, here comes the traditional warm fuzzies of the season, primarily aimed at those who celebrate Christmas whether in the Christian sense or any other sense.

What's your favorite Christmas memory? (Go ahead and get all sappy. It's Christmas!)

Mine was when I was about five. My oldest brother swore he was going to wait up until he heard Santa Claus in the front room, then go out and get a look at him. I agreed with my other brother that we should all wait up. We waited in our rooms with the doors just slightly ajar. At some point in the middle of the night, we heard shuffling around in the house. Just as we were about to put our daring plan into action, a bag full of toys spilled in the hallway! Santa used some very unChristmassy-like words, in fact they were words we often heard my father use when something aggravating had happened, and then some shadowy form started gathering up the toys.

We pussed out. One of my brothers said "Santa's here! Get back to bed or he'll take away all the toys!" No way in hell were we going to risk that! Some things you just don't bet a Spirograph against! Of course, my parents had these smug grins the following morning, knowing that they had almost gotten caught. I'll never forget that one!
